  <default_description>Dominick Dunne was a ringside witness to the O.J. Simpson criminal trial,  about which he wrote extensively for &lt;I&gt;Vanity Fair&lt;/I&gt; magazine. In &lt;I&gt;Another City,  Not My Own&lt;/I&gt;, he revisits the case, this time in fictional form. In this &quot;novel in  the form of a memoir,&quot; Dunne's fiction skates perilously close to fact in most  instances. O.J., Marcia Clark, Johnnie Cochran, and a whole host of celebrity characters  keep their own names while the life story of protagonist Gus Bailey closely follows  Dunne's own. Like Dunne, Bailey--who has appeared in previous works by the author--is  a journalist, the father of a murdered child and thus a keen chronicler of the American  justice system. The O.J. Simpson trial is a natural magnet for such a man. &lt;P&gt; Throughout the novel, Bailey spends his days in the courtroom and his evenings at  celebrity-studded soirees; names such as Heidi Fleiss, Elizabeth Taylor, and Kirk  Douglas punctuate the narrative as Dunne comments on the case, the sensibilities of both  the accused and his accusers, and the roles of race, fame, and guilt in America today. But  shocking as the Simpson case was, Dunne's denouement to his fictional memoir is  &lt;I&gt;so&lt;/I&gt; bizarre that it may well eclipse the verdict entirely.</default_description>
